Overview: At the recent Freehold Township School Board meeting, the board discussed a significant potential grant application aimed at improving water quality across district schools. Amid concerns about traceable levels of lead found in drinking fountains and sinks, the board is seeking approximately $426,000 in competitive grant funds to replace affected units with filtered bottle filling stations and perform associated infrastructure updates. The district worked with a manufacturer to identify up to 71 units eligible for replacement, with each unit’s replacement cost estimated not to exceed $6,000. The timeline for grant approval remains uncertain, but the district hopes to promptly commence replacements upon receiving the funds.
